Core Spreads vs IG - Headquarters And Year Of Founding
Core Spreads was founded in 2014 and has its headquaters in London.
IG was founded in 1974 and has its headquaters in UK.
What is the minimum deposit for IG or Core Spreads
The minimum deposit for Core Spreads is $1.
The minimum deposit for IG is $200.

Core Spreads vs IG - Regulation And Licencing In More Detail
Core Spreads is regulated by Financial Conduct Authority (FCA).
IG is regulated by Financial Conduct Authority (FCA), Australian Securities and Investment Commission (ASIC).

But this doesn't necessarily m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for a variety of services to make money. There are primarily three different types of fees for this objective.
The first sort of fees to look out for are trading fees. Whenever you make an actual trade, like buying a stock or an ETF, you are charged trading fees. In these cases, you are paying a spread, financing rate, or even a commission. The kinds of trading charges and the prices differ from broker to broker.
Commissions could be fixed or determined by the traded quantity. On the other hand, a spread denotes the gap between the buying and selling price. Funding or overnight prices are those who are billed when you maintain a leveraged position for more than a day.
Apart from trading fees, online agents also bill non-trading fees. These are determined by the activities you undertake in your account. They are charged for operations like depositing cash, not investing for long periods, or withdrawals.
